ForgottenAmnesia  [author] 22 Sep, 2018 @ 3:12pm 
When scaling down the Values are not always perfect. This mod just changes the gain value of all the enemies in the game to be roughly 1/4 of their original value. I havnt run into any issues with enemies not giving exp. If you tell me what enemy it was i can try to look into it but be careful of conflicts. if any mod overwrites a characters entry it will conflict with this mod and the mod lower in your order wins.
